LDL-C Reagent Kit for DIRUI Clinical Chemistry Analyzers

LDL-C Reagent Kit for DIRUI Clinical Chemistry Analyzers

(0 review)

The LDL-C Reagent Kit is a premium clinical chemistry reagent specifically formulated for the quantitative determination of Low-Density Lipoprotein Cholesterol (LDL-C) in human serum or plasma using DIRUI Clinical Chemistry Analyzers. Designed to deliver accurate, precise, and reproducible results, this reagent supports routine lipid profile testing and assists healthcare professionals in evaluating cardiovascular risk, cholesterol metabolism, and lipid disorders.

Optimized for seamless compatibility with DIRUI automated chemistry analyzers, the LDL-C Reagent Kit provides excellent analytical sensitivity, reagent stability, and consistent performance. It is ideal for hospitals, diagnostic laboratories, pathology laboratories, research institutions, and clinical testing facilities.

Specifications

  • Product Name: LDL-C Reagent Kit
  • Compatibility: DIRUI Clinical Chemistry Analyzers
  • Analyte: Low-Density Lipoprotein Cholesterol (LDL-C)
  • Specimen: Serum and Plasma (according to laboratory protocol)
  • Application: Quantitative LDL Cholesterol Determination
  • Use: Clinical Diagnostic Laboratory Testing
